Man who punched gas attendant gets 1 day in prison

A man who punched and threatened to kill a male gas attendant at a gasoline station in Chalan Piao has pleaded guilty plea and was sentenced to one-year in prison, all suspended except for one day. Inario Bisanen, 37, was given credit for one day of time served; this means he...

29,000 stimulus checks totaling $45 million issued

The Department of Finance has already issued approximately 29,000 economic impact payments—more popularly known as “stimulus checks”—totaling around $45 million. Finance’s Division of Revenue & Taxation is now working on issuing batches of payments every Friday, to provide...

Alyssa Gordon wins UOG’s first-ever Sociology Award

Senior sociology major Alyssa Gordon has been named the winner of the University of Guam Sociology Program’s first-ever I Kannai Gi Tano’ (Hand in the Land) Sociology Award. The award recognizes the efforts and qualities of an outstanding sociology student who contributes to the...
